Samsung working on a new M series smartphone, Galaxy M52 5G

Samsung will soon be bringing a new smartphone in the M series, which will be the Galaxy M52 5G. The phone has recently received certification from the Bluetooth SIG authority and it is expected that it will launch by the end of this month. The listing shows the phone with two model numbers SM-M526BR_DS and SM-M526B_DS. The smartphone has also been listed previously on the Bureau of Indian Standards (BIS) and China’s 3C authority which confirms that the phone is ready to launch. 

There have also been a lot of new leaks about the hardware specification of the smartphone which includes a 6.7-inch SAMOLED FHD+ screen. The phone is expected to be powered using a Snapdragon 778 chipset and will be paired with at least 6 or 8GB of RAM and 128GB of internal storage. When it comes to the camera unit, a triple camera setup is expected on the rear where the primary camera sensor will be 64MP, including a 12MP wide-angle lens and 5MP depth sensor lens. 

The front will get a 32MP selfie camera sensor. Apart from these major features, the display will be protected using Gorilla Glass 5, as Samsung has started using Gorilla Glass on many of their new smartphones. The phone will be running on Android 11 out of the box and will have support for 11 5G bands. There is no information on the pricing yet, but it is expected to be above the $450 mark for now.
